Abstract EN

In this paper, we want to find out whether gender bias will affect the success and whether there are some common laws driving the success in show business.

We design an experiment, set the gender and productivity of an actor or actress in a certain period as the independent variables, and introduce deep learning techniques to do the prediction of success, extract the latent features, and understand the data we use.

Three models have been trained: the first one is trained by the data of an actor, the second one is trained by the data of an actress, and the third one is trained by the mixed data.

Three benchmark models are constructed with the same conditions.

The experiment results show that our models are more general and accurate than benchmarks.

An interesting finding is that the models trained by the data of an actor/actress only achieve similar performance on the data of another gender without performance loss.

It shows that the gender bias is weakly related to success.

Through the visualization of the feature maps in the embedding space, we see that prediction models have learned some common laws although they are trained by different data.

Using the above findings, a more general and accurate model to predict the success in show business can be built.
